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(approx. 1.5 lbs)
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 4 minced garlic cloves
  • 2 tsp ground cumin
  • 2 tsp smoked paprika
  • Juice of 1 lemon
  • 4 tortillas or pita bread
  • 2 cups mixed fresh vegetables (lettuce, tomatoes, cucumbers)
  • ½ cup tahini sauce or garlic sauce

Instructions

  1. Marinate the chicken by mixing olive oil, garlic, cumin, smoked paprika, and lemon juice in a bowl. Coat the chicken breasts evenly and let them marinate for at least 30 minutes.
  2. Heat a skillet over medium-high heat and cook the marinated chicken for about 7-10 minutes on each side until golden brown and fully cooked (165°F).
  3. While the chicken cooks, chop the fresh vegetables into bite-sized pieces.
  4. After cooking, slice the chicken thinly and assemble the wraps by placing the chicken and veggies down the center of each tortilla or pita.
  5. Drizzle with tahini or garlic sauce before wrapping tightly. Serve immediately.
